Hebei authorities forcefully erected a flagpole with the Chinese flag outside the church of the Roman Catholic Diocese of Zhengding, the residence of Bishop Julius Jia Zhiguo, one the most prominent leaders of the Underground Catholic Church.
National symbols and Party propaganda play an essential role in President Xi Jinpings sinicization policy. The initiative to hoist the national flag outside the places of worship, proposed by the state-sanctioned religious institutions in July this year, raised concerns among the underground Catholics as yet one more step toward the eradication of churches loyal to the Vatican.
In display of power, authorities in the northern province of Hebei raised the Chinas national flag outside the church of the Roman Catholic Diocese of Zhengding, the home of Bishop Julius Jia Zhiguo who has been detained multiple times and held under house arrest for nearly 30 years because of his refusal to join the government-approved Patriotic Catholic Church.
Party cadres showed up at the church in the village of Wuqiu in Jinzhou city on October 1 and forcibly dug up a pit to erect the flagpole. Bishop Jia, closely supervised by the authorities even at his residence, opposed the act and reiterated that the church was a place to worship God, not the Chinese flag.
According to eyewitnesses, to block the officials, an elderly friar jumped into the pit that was being dug, but the village cadres threatened to bury him alive if he did not come out of it.
